Bit 6 - EN_RRCx - Enables ramp rate control when the corresponding fan driver is operated in the
Direct Setting Mode.
Bit 5 - GLITCH_ENx - Disables the low pass glitch filter that removes high frequency noise injected
on the TACHx pin.
Bits 4 - 3 - DER_OPTx[1:0] - Control some of the advanced options that affect the derivative portion
of the RPM-based Fan Speed Control Algorithm as shown in
Bit 2 - 1 - ERR_RNGx[1:0] - Control some of the advanced options that affect the error window. When
the measured fan speed is within the programmed error window around the target speed, then the fan
drive setting is not updated. The algorithm will continue to monitor the fan speed and calculate
necessary drive setting changes based on the error; however, these changes are ignored.

‘0’ (default) - Ramp rate control is disabled. When the fan driver is operating in Direct Setting mode,
the fan setting will instantly transition to the next programmed setting.
‘1’ - Ramp rate control is enabled. When the fan driver is operating in Direct Setting mode, the fan
drive setting will follow the ramp rate controls as determined by the Fan Step and Update Time
settings. The maximum fan drive setting step is capped at the Fan Step setting and is updated
based on the Update Time as given by
‘0’ - The glitch filter is disabled.
‘1’ (default) - The glitch filter is enabled.
